Check engine light

It is recommended to take your vehicle to a mechanic if you see the check engine light on it. Although you can purchase a DIY code reader and do some of the diagnostics yourself, these tools aren't sophisticated enough to offer a reliable diagnosis. Additionally, the instruments used in auto repair shops are expensive and require technicians to be trained. Furthermore, many vehicles contain manufacturer-specific trouble codes that cannot be interpreted without an advanced reader.

The Check Engine Light is a sign that your vehicle's control system isn't functioning properly. The Check Engine Light might come on for a few seconds due to a loose gas cap. If this problem is not appropriately addressed, it could result in a costly repair bill.

If you notice flashing Check Engine light on your car, get it checked by an experienced mechanic as quickly as you can. There are a myriad of reasons for the Check Engine lights to flash. It could be due to a minor issue like a loose gas cap or an underlying problem like a faulty oxygen sensor, transmission, or other problem. If you do not address the issue, it may get worse, leading to expensive repairs and a higher repair cost.

Special tools

Tools are vital for automotive technicians. The proper tools can make a big difference. As a mobile technician you'll have to rely on your tools even more than normal. While you may not have given tools much thought prior to but they are now crucial to the success of your mobile auto diagnostics.

There are two major kinds of diagnostic tools for cars. One is a code reader, and the other is an advanced scan tool. A basic scan tool can allow you to read and erase codes as well as a more advanced one will let you view available data from your car's computer. These tools can also be used to perform system tests or let you manually activate components.

OBDroid is a fault code reader, connects to the car's OBD-II port. It can also read trouble codes and reveal the efficiency of your vehicle's fuel consumption. OBDroid is simple to use and comes with features that help diagnose engine problems. It comes with a menu that shows trouble codes and explanations. Another alternative is the alOBD ScanGenPro, which can record real-time sensor data and export a array of data. It can also be tailored to specific parameters of the vehicle.

In some cases sensors in cars send out abnormal data to the ECU and it stores the data as a Diagnostic Trouble Code. The trouble code usually has a cause, so it is recommended to fix it before the light turns on.

Cost

Maintenance of vehicles is not complete without the use of auto diagnostics. They ensure that vehicles run smoothly and prevent costly breakdowns. The process involves the use of special tools and a visual inspection to identify issues. Mobile mechanics can also inspect your exhaust system to ensure that it doesn't emit harmful substances. The process can even improve the efficiency of your car and keep you from breathing fumes, which is beneficial for the environment.

A diagnostic test typically cost around $100, although it is possible to find lower-cost options. Certain diagnostic tests can cost as low as $20 or as much as $400, based on the kind of issue and the mechanic.
